Welcome to the Veterans Resource Center
The mission of the Veterans Resource Center (VRC) at ¶¶Òõ¶ÌÊÓƵ is to assist military and veteran students in making a successful transition from military to academic life by providing information, tools, and comprehensive programs that increase student academic success and completion of their academic goal.
The VRC provides a warm and welcoming place for veterans to connect with one another and learn about available campus services. Come by and see us in Library 109. We are here to help you succeed!

¶¶Òõ¶ÌÊÓƵ adheres to : Principles of Excellence for Educational Institutions Serving Veterans, and implements the recently announced by the White House. These principles ensure that Gavilan is providing meaningful information to service members, veterans, spouses, and other family members about the financial cost and quality of education, to assist prospective students in making choices about how to use their Federal educational benefits
